Jiachuan Pan is a scholar working on Molecular Biology, Molecular Medicine and Endocrinology. According to data from OpenAlex, Jiachuan Pan has authored 15 papers receiving a total of 371 indexed citations (citations by other indexed papers that have themselves been cited), including 11 papers in Molecular Biology, 5 papers in Molecular Medicine and 3 papers in Endocrinology. Recurrent topics in Jiachuan Pan's work include Bacterial biofilms and quorum sensing (7 papers), Antibiotic Resistance in Bacteria (5 papers) and Vibrio bacteria research studies (3 papers). Jiachuan Pan is often cited by papers focused on Bacterial biofilms and quorum sensing (7 papers), Antibiotic Resistance in Bacteria (5 papers) and Vibrio bacteria research studies (3 papers). Jiachuan Pan collaborates with scholars based in United States and China. Jiachuan Pan's co-authors include Dacheng Ren, Ali Adem Bahar, Fangchao Song, Yanwei Ji, Jianlong Wang, Ganwei Zhang, Xiang Li, Yanru Wang, Wenxin Zhu and Pengli Guo and has published in prestigious journals such as PLoS ONE, Applied and Environmental Microbiology and Journal of Agricultural and Food Chemistry.
